On January 24, Russian skier Daria Nepryaeva managed to overcome the qualifying stage for the first time this season and qualify for the sprint classic at the World Cup, which takes place in Goms, Switzerland.
In the women's qualification, Sweden's Lynn Swan showed the best time, covering the distance in 3 minutes 46.07 seconds. Nepryaeva was 15.15 seconds behind the leader and reached the quarterfinals, taking 29th place. She showed the result in 4 minutes and 1.2 seconds, complements the "Sport-Express".
In the men's sprint, Johannes Klebo, a five-time Olympic champion from Norway, won the qualification with a time of 3 minutes and 18.2 seconds.
